Generating OTP 823a0fe1c025e890cfca8d8ae03644ba9af7782b5c6a0803640dd16a1395f246 for 216.73.216.233. Result is 3f2c65757756740c4ada89ada3fbe7ab102ba281f57139f82b87f57df42d855e